Getting married at Fidalgo Bay RV Resort, Cabins and Event Venue
Two things make the tour worth the drive. First, see the ceremony spot at the exact time of day you'd say your vows — a west-facing beach glows at sunset but bakes at noon, and you'll want to feel the wind, watch where the sun sits, and walk the path your guests take across the sand. Second, bring your real questions: the weather backup (where does the ceremony move if it rains or the wind kicks up?), who pulls the beach permit, the sound-ordinance curfew, the catering and bar policy, and exactly what's included — chairs, setup, and teardown on sand are where quotes quietly diverge. Peak beach dates book 12–18 months out, so if the tour feels right, ask what's open in your season before you leave.
